When is the Best Time to Visit Medellín
The best months to visit Medellín, Colombia, are generally from December to March and July to August. During these times, the weather is typically dry, with pleasant temperatures and less rainfall, making it ideal for exploring the city and enjoying outdoor activities. Additionally, visiting during the holiday season in December offers a chance to experience the vibrant Christmas lights and festivities that Medellín is known for.

Medellín
Medellín, known as the “City of Eternal Spring,” offers a vibrant blend of culture, nightlife, and natural beauty. Here’s a guide to help you make the most of your visit:
### Nightlife:
1. **El Social**:
– **Location**: El Poblado
– **Features**: Known for its laid-back vibe and local crowd, it’s perfect for enjoying traditional Colombian drinks like aguardiente. They often have live music events, which make for a lively evening.
2. **Salon Amador**:
– **Location**: El Poblado
– **Features**: A popular club offering electronic music with both local and international DJs. It’s well-known for themed nights and a vibrant dance floor.
3. **Alambique**:
– **Location**: Near Parque Lleras
– **Features**: A hidden rooftop bar known for its creative cocktails and eclectic decor. They host live music sessions that range from jazz to indie.
### Popular Excursions:
1. **Guatapé and El Peñol Rock**:
– **Description**: A colorful town with vibrant zócalos (paintings) and the famous El Peñol Rock, which offers stunning views of the surrounding lakes. Climb up its 740 steps for a breathtaking panorama.
2. **Santa Fe de Antioquia**:
– **Description**: A charming colonial town with cobblestone streets and historic architecture. It’s a great day trip to experience Colombia’s colonial past.
3. **Parque Arví**:
– **Description**: An ecological nature reserve accessible by cable car from the city. Ideal for hiking, picnicking, and enjoying guided nature tours.
### Restaurants:
1. **La Hacienda** ($):
– **Location**: Laureles
– **Specialties**: A great spot for traditional Colombian dishes like bandeja paisa and mondongo. It offers a cozy atmosphere with friendly service.
2. **Carmen** ($$$):
– **Location**: El Poblado
– **Specialties**: Renowned for its innovative fusion of Colombian and international flavors. The tasting menu is highly recommended for a special dining experience.
3. **Mondongo’s** ($$):
– **Location**: El Poblado and Laureles
– **Specialties**: Famous for its mondongo soup, a traditional Colombian dish. It’s a popular spot among locals and tourists alike for authentic flavors.
### Venues to Visit:
1. **Museo de Antioquia**:
– **Description**: Located in the city center, this museum houses an extensive collection of works by Fernando Botero, as well as pre-Columbian, colonial, and contemporary art.
2. **Parque Explora**:
– **Description**: A science and technology museum with interactive exhibits, an aquarium, and a planetarium. It’s perfect for families and those interested in science.
3. **Casa de la Memoria Museum**:
– **Description**: A museum dedicated to the memory of the victims of Colombia’s armed conflict, offering insightful exhibits on the country’s history and peace-building efforts.
